Explore LAIR at Los Angeles Zoo

Animal lovers catching flights to Los Angeles for a break on America's west coast this year can enjoy some new wildlife encounters in the city.

Los Angeles Zoo and Botanical Gardens recently opened a new exhibit entitled LAIR, which stands for living amphibians, invertebrates and reptiles.

The complex provides a new habitat for the zoo's collection of reptiles, which is known for its rare animals.

Visitors to the new conservation facility can look out for Chinese giant salamanders, crocodiles, venomous snakes, scorpions, blue frogs and more.

Los Angeles Zoo is also home to a wide range of mammals, including chimpanzees, black bears, elephants, giraffes and jaguars, as well as a dedicated gorilla reserve.

Other attractions on offer in LA this year include the Cirque du Soleil show Iris: A Journey through the World of Cinema, which debuted at the Kodak Theatre, the home of the Academy Awards, in July 2011.

The production combines acrobatics, dance, projections and live music.
